Basement leak repair services involve identifying and fixing sources of water intrusion in the foundation or walls of a basement. These services typically include inspecting the area for cracks, damaged seals, or faulty drainage systems, then implementing solutions such as sealing cracks, installing waterproof membranes, or improving drainage around the property. The goal is to prevent water from seeping into the basement, which can lead to further damage and costly repairs if left unaddressed. Skilled service providers use a variety of techniques to ensure the space stays dry and protected from future leaks.

Many homeowners turn to basement leak repair when they notice signs of water intrusion, such as damp or moldy walls, musty odors, or visible water stains. Leaks can occur due to various issues, including heavy rainfall, poor drainage, foundation cracks, or aging materials. Addressing these problems promptly can help prevent structural damage, mold growth, and damage to stored belongings. The overview below groups typical Basement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anderson,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or leak fixes or patching range from $250 to $600. Many routine projects fall within this middle band, covering common repairs around the basement. Fewer jobs reach the higher end of this range unless additional work is needed.

Moderate Repairs - more extensive leak repairs or localized pipe replacements usually cost between $600 and $1,500.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, which covers a variety of common basement leak issues. Larger or more complex repairs can push costs higher.

Major Repairs - significant leaks, foundation sealing, or extensive waterproofing can range from $1,500 to $4,000. These projects are less frequent but may involve multiple areas or structural work requiring specialized skills from local service providers.

Full Basement Waterproofing - comprehensive waterproofing or basement overhaul projects typically cost $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Such large-scale projects are less common but necessary for serious flooding or foundation issues, with costs varying based on the scope of work invol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es basement leaks? Basement leaks can result from issues such as foundation cracks, poor drainage, or plumbing failures that allow water to seep into the space.

How do contractors typically fix basement leaks? Local contractors may use methods like sealing cracks, installing sump pumps, or waterproofing membranes to prevent water intrusion.

Are basement leak repairs permanent? Repair solutions aim to be durable, but the longevity depends on the cause of the leak and proper maintenance over time.

What signs indicate a basement may have a leak? Signs include damp walls, musty odors, water stains, or pooling water after rain or snowmelt.

Can basement leaks be prevented? Proper drainage, regular inspections, and timely repairs of cracks or foundation issues can help reduce the risk of future leaks.
